Promotion to Nemzeti Bajnokság I came in the 2024/2025 season, when Szigetszentmiklósi KSK won the NB I/B championship and reached the top flight for the first time. The Hungarian Cup has never been part of that record.

The club traces back to 1992, formed to carry on the men's and women's handball sections of Csepel Autógyár after that club's programme was shut down in 1990. A first promotion came in the 2010/2011 season, when the team topped the NB II Western Group, built largely around players who had come up through the club's own youth ranks rather than signings brought in from outside.

Home games are played at the SZKSK Kézilabda Csarnok, a hall that holds 420 people, in Szigetszentmiklós south of Budapest.

Imre Vilmos took over as head coach with a résumé that includes spells at Dunaferr, Csurgó and Balatonfüred, as well as a stint in charge of the Hungarian women's national team. The squad that carried the club into NB I/B and beyond mixed homegrown players with imports such as German line player Ron Dieffenbacher, signed from Füchse Berlin, and Dutch left back Destin van Dijk, who arrived from Bevo HC.

In Pest county, the fixture against Budai Farkasok-Rév is the one that matters most. Regionally, Gyáli BKSE, Mogyoródi KSK and Ceglédi Kék Cápák provide the more regular competition. Now in the top flight, Szigetszentmiklósi KSK faces a different class of opponent altogether: Ferencvárosi TC, Veszprém KC, Pick Szeged and Tatabánya KC.
